Scope and Contents

Inventory record for the State of Oregon Inventory of Historic Properties, record for “The Beekman Bank”; Newspaper clipping with article “Chinese Mining Camp to be Excavated” by Richard Cockle, published in the Oregonian on April 16th, 1992; Miscellaneous handwritten research notes; Business card for the “Chinese Art Studio”; Jackson County’s Banking History: The First Bank in Jackson County, Oregon The Beekman Banking House; Excerpt from “Gold in the Woodpile”; Newspaper clipping with article titled “Life on Applegate in the Late 1850’s Recorded in Diary” by Betty Miller
